Section 626. Budget Implementation.--(a) Except as provided
in subsection (b), before the enactment of the General
Appropriation Act for the current fiscal year, the State
Treasurer may not release or approve the transfer of State funds
to an administrative agency or the General Assembly for any
expense that would result in the disbursement of State funds
beyond the amount that was enacted or funds not included in the
General Appropriation Act for the prior fiscal year.
(b) The following expenditures are not subject to subsection
(a):
(1) Expenditures required under the Fair Labor Standards Act
of 1938 (52 Stat. 1060, 29 U.S.C. ยง 201 et seq.).
(2) Expenditures required in compliance with Federal or
State court decisions.
(c) As used in this section, "administrative agency" shall
mean:
(1) An agency or department of the Commonwealth within the
executive branch.
(2) The Office of the Governor.
(3) The Office of the Lieutenant Governor.
(4) The Office of Attorney General.
(5) The Department of the Auditor General.
(6) The Treasury Department.
(7) An independent board or commission.
Section 2. This act shall take effect in 60 days.
